The units of measure used in this tool are the following:

 

TIME UNITS:
oh: The hour is a unit of measurement of time. In modern usage, an hour comprises 60 minutes, or 3,600 seconds.
omin: A minute is a unit of measurement of time. The minute is a unit of time equal to 1/60th of an hour or 60 seconds.
os: The second is a unit of measurement of time, and is the International System of Units (SI) base unit of time.
LENGHT UNITS:
om: The metre (or meter) is the base unit of length in the International System of Units (SI).
ocm: A centimetre (American spelling: centimeter) is a unit of length in the metric system, equal to one hundredth of a metre, which is the SI base unit of length.
okm: The kilometre (American spelling: kilometer) is a unit of length in the metric system, equal to one thousand metres.
VOLUME UNITS:
oL: The litre (or liter) is a unit of volume equal to 1 cubic decimetre (dm3), to 1,000 cubic centimetres (cm3), and to 1/1,000 cubic metre.
om3: The cubic metre (US spelling: cubic meter) is the SI derived unit of volume. It is the volume of a cube with edges one metre in length.
MASS UNITS:
okg: The kilogram or kilogramme is the base unit of mass in the International System of Units.
ot: The ton is a unit ofmass equal to 1,000 kilograms (kg).
